Board.KolibriOS.org

Official KolibriOS board
It is currently Wed Jun 03, 2020 1:41 pm

All times are UTC+03:00




Post new topic  Reply to topic  [ 56 posts ]  Go to page Previous 1 2 3 4
Author Message
PostPosted: Sun Apr 24, 2011 1:02 pm 
Offline

Joined: Mon Sep 24, 2007 11:11 am
Posts: 2814
Нет, обсуждения эмулятора ZX Spectrum в другой теме. Б3-34 - это калькулятор такой.
В каждой игре, замечу, управление свое. Кроме того, у спектрума всего 40 кнопок. Стрелки работать не будут, в общем.


Top
   
PostPosted: Mon Apr 25, 2011 8:02 am 
Перенес последние 4 сообщения из темы Эмулятор Б3-34


Top
   
PostPosted: Mon Apr 25, 2011 8:59 am 
Offline
User avatar

Joined: Thu Mar 01, 2007 7:57 pm
Posts: 835
Sorcerer wrote:
Нет, обсуждения эмулятора ZX Spectrum в другой теме. Б3-34 - это калькулятор такой.
В каждой игре, замечу, управление свое. Кроме того, у спектрума всего 40 кнопок. Стрелки работать не будут, в общем.

И как же управлять?

_________________
Всех выше те, кто доброе творят,
И за дела добра не ждут наград,
Всем жертвуют для страждущих людей,
Не думая о выгоде своей.


Top
   
PostPosted: Mon Apr 25, 2011 9:35 am 
Кнопками которые заданы в игре по умолчанию, обычно это W A S D.


Top
   
PostPosted: Mon Apr 25, 2011 12:50 pm 
Offline
Mentor
User avatar

Joined: Tue Jan 15, 2008 11:27 am
Posts: 755
В играх для спекки часто кнопки по умолчанию - Q,A (вверх, вниз) и O,P (влево, вправо).


Top
   
PostPosted: Thu Apr 11, 2019 2:06 pm 
Offline

Joined: Mon Mar 27, 2006 6:33 am
Posts: 678
Встретился эмулятор с исходниками написанный на С-- (95г Кладов)
Emuz
Возможно имеет некоторый смысл запустить его в КолибриОС.

P.S. Там же есть какой то вариант на asm.
В эмуляторе ZX-Spectruma могла бы быть, наверное полезна, возможность распозновать выводимый текст на ZX экранной памяти и отображать его качественным шрифтом. Может ещё какая нибудь функция по возможности убирания клэшинга в каких то играх.

Интерес "навеян" статьёй с хабр :)
Сергей Зонов: «Первый „Спектрум“ я сделал потому, что мне было интересно»

Своё Спектрум железо не включал более 20-ти лет, а когда то, даже для производства сделана была одна система на ассемблере для 8085 процессорa, а знание ассемблера Z-80 привело к первой программерской работе в далёком 93году:)
а далее уже и к 386-м IBM совместимым компьютерам.


Top
   
PostPosted: Fri Apr 12, 2019 1:35 pm 
Online
Designer
User avatar

Joined: Thu Jan 25, 2007 3:33 pm
Posts: 5277
Проект большой, я наврядли смогу его портировать.
Написал автору, быть может он сделает это за небольшое вознаграждение. Думаю, 100$.
Главное чтобы ему было это интересно. Если попросит больше, покраудфандим.

_________________
Звиздеть не мешки ворочать


Top
   
PostPosted: Tue Jul 02, 2019 12:38 pm 
Offline

Joined: Mon Mar 27, 2006 6:33 am
Posts: 678
Немного не в тематике топика, но всё же близко и ассемблерной тематике.

Около спектрумовское "мероприятие"
Статья на хабр и конкурс написания игр для ZX-Spectrum до 3-го декабря 2019г.

P.S. Местный эмулятор может тоже сгодится для реализации оригинальных игр для ZX-Spectrum и для добавления их в KolibriOS.
(если найдутся желающие тряхнуть "стариной") :)


Top
   
PostPosted: Sun Apr 26, 2020 8:19 pm 
Offline
Mentor
User avatar

Joined: Tue Jan 15, 2008 11:27 am
Posts: 755
Всем привет! За два вечера немного почистил код эмулятора (удалил в том числе и вызов msgbox) и сделал makefile для Linux x86-64. Just for fun. Может, когда-то и функционал добавлю - по крайней мере, сейчас это сделать будет проще. Из изменений также возможность скомпилировать эмулятор с другим ROM (для примера положил в соответствующую папку ROM от Робика).

Исходники: https://github.com/Albom/e80

Исполняемый файл (несжатый kpack-ом) - во вложении.


Attachments:
e80.zip [33.5 KiB]
Downloaded 8 times
Top
   
PostPosted: Sun Apr 26, 2020 11:13 pm 
Offline
User avatar

Joined: Mon Oct 27, 2008 10:10 pm
Posts: 821
Обновить программу на svn?


Top
   
PostPosted: Mon Apr 27, 2020 2:04 am 
Offline
Mentor
User avatar

Joined: Tue Jan 15, 2008 11:27 am
Posts: 755
Quote:
Обновить программу на svn?

Думаю, пока не нужно. Функционала меньше, полноценно программа не тестировалась.


Top
   
Display posts from previous:  Sort by  
Post new topic  Reply to topic  [ 56 posts ]  Go to page Previous 1 2 3 4

All times are UTC+03:00


Who is online

Users browsing this forum: No registered users and 0 guests


You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ot post attachments in this forum

Search for:
Jump to:  
Powered by phpBB® Forum Software © phpBB Limited